Thomas 8 was archbishop of Sardinia; in 787 he was represented at the Second Council of Nikaia (the Seventh Ecumenical Council) by a deacon from the church of Katana (in Sicily), Epiphanios 3: Mansi XII 994, XII 1022, XII 1031, XII 1075, XII 1090, XII 1150, XIII 136, XIII 365, XIII 381 (Θωμᾶ ἀρχιεπισκόπου Σαρδινίας or similar).
